Default fault code 0175

hey all, i've seen 0175 before but it was also with 0174,(right system to rich, lean). this happened at idle last time and then again this time with 0175. my engine started shuttering and shaking violently almost dying. then she picked back up and idled just fine. does anybody have any thoughts?

thanks.

Default RE: fault code 0175

P0175 (M) 2/1 Fuel System Rich A rich air/fuel mixture has been indicated by an abnormally lean correction factor.

Default RE: fault code 0175

well an update for anybody who comes accross this problem. i have finally solved the misfire that has been plaguing me for the past couple of months. its the O2 sensors. im not sure which one(s) so i replaced them all. along with the 0175 i got 0174. the 02 sensor was doing its job but not efficiently. it became sluggish. thats why it would swing from rich to lean. seeing how they are heated, also solved the other issue where i missfired until my engine was up to operating temp, ie the exhaust gas. they aren't cheap but it will stop the headache with about an hours worth of work. thanks for the help in the other posts as well.
